Letter from Roscoe B. Moore to Theodore Roosevelt

Letter from Roscoe B. Moore to Theodore Roosevelt

Roscoe B. Moore writes to President Roosevelt from South Dakota Penitentiary asking for Roosevelt’s help. Moore served with the 1st Volunteer Cavalry, also known as the Rough Riders, and as a member he asks for Roosevelt’s help in either getting his prison sentence shortened or raffling off a hand made saddle so that money can be sent to Moore’s family in New Mexico.
